Before 2005, cartoon entertainment was controlled by three major players: Cartoon Network, Nickelodeon, and Disney Channel. These networks operated on scarcity. If you missed an episode of SpongeBob , you might wait months for a rerun. DVDs were expensive, and syndication was slow. Yes, content farms churn out hollow, profitable sludge

At its core, refers to animated content specifically designed for distribution via internet video platforms (tubes). Unlike traditional broadcast animation, which follows strict episode lengths, seasonal structures, and network approval processes, tube cartoons are agile, data-driven, and often ephemeral.
